Responsibilities and Duties:

  • Medically responsible for all clients enrolled in the treatment program, to include special populations (e.g., pregnant clients, HIV+, clients with Hepatitis C, clients with co-occurring disorders).
  • Must be able to assess suitability of individuals applying for
    admission as well as their ongoing physical and mental stability for outpatient substance abuse
    treatment.
  • Ensure the timely completion of admission physicals, annual physicals, medical histories, laboratory testing (including TB screening) consistent with state and federal regulations, accreditation standards and sound medical practice
  • Review all laboratory results as well as medical documentation from other healthcare providers and manage each client according to established best practice and accrediting and regulatory guidelines
  • Screen clients for common medical co-morbidities and evaluate co-existing medical conditions to identify potential medication impact/drug interactions, to include over-the counter (OTC) medications
  • Prescribe and titrate the appropriate dosage of methadone consistent with the client's medical and addiction history to establish a maintenance dose
  • Order dose increases, decreases, detoxification, or supervised withdrawal after assessment of the client and his/her current treatment history
  • Write medical orders based upon the individual needs of the client and sign off on all medical orders
